I just wanted to give an update on my issue with the hologram tote being too unstructured for me. At the recommendation from someone in this thread (sorry, I can't remember who it was!) I ordered a Purse to Go from Purse Bling. I ordered the Extra Jumbo and the height was exactly what I wanted as it didn't cause the tote to cave it around the top of the organizer and possibly leave indentations. However, the main reason I wanted an organizer was because the corners of the tote were already caving in and I wanted an organizer to fill in that space, so to speak. The Purse to Go has an oval shape and unfortunately it did not go all the way to the corners so it will not work for this tote. The good news is that it works perfectly in the Kate Spade tote I'm currently using for work that also has no structure so I am glad I bought it even though it didn't work for the bag I bought it for. I'm going to see if Purse to Go offers a tall one with a more rectangular base, or if Divide and Conquer (the organizer I previously used) has a tall option.

Have you looked at cloverSac organizers. They have plastic inserts that make the organizer rigid on the side and bottom and they come in many sizes. I use mine in a very large shopper tote. They come from Taiwan and take several weeks to get here, but they are worth it and are not that expensive. Here is mine which is the medium size. I pulled the plastic out of the side so you could see it.
